skill写的pcell怎么保存
时间: 2023-12-29 18:00:31 浏览: 37
当你使用Skill写的PCELL时,你可以通过以下几种方式来保存它:
1. 将PCELL保存在本地计算机上的特定文件夹中。你可以在设计环境中直接将PCELL保存到你选择的文件夹中,以便日后随时调用和使用。
2. 将PCELL保存在版本控制系统中,比如Git或SVN。这样可以确保PCELL的变化和修改都能被完整记录和追溯,方便团队协作和版本管理。
3. 将PCELL上传至云端存储服务,比如Google Drive、Dropbox或OneDrive。这样可以确保PCELL的安全备份,即使本地计算机故障,你仍然能够轻松地获取和使用PCELL。
4. 如果PCELL是作为一个库的一部分,你可以使用库管理系统来保存和管理PCELL。这样可以确保PCELL能够被正确地引用和调用,减少了重复劳动和出错的可能性。
无论你选择哪种保存方式,都应该确保PCELL的完整性和可靠性。在保存PCELL的同时,最好也记录下对PCELL的修改和更新,以便日后追溯和回溯。这样可以最大限度地提高PCELL的重复利用和可维护性。
相关问题
用skill实现给pcell加入cdf
以下是使用 SKILL 为 PCell 添加 CDF 的一般步骤:
1. 打开设计工具中的 SKILL 编辑器,并创建一个新的 SKILL 文件。
2. 定义一个函数,该函数将创建 PCell 并添加所需的 CDF 属性。例如:
```
(defun add-cdf-to-pcell ()
(let ((new-pcell (make-pcell 'my-pcell)))
(set-cdf-property new-pcell "my-property" 1.0)
(set-cdf-property new-pcell "my-other-property" "some value")
new-pcell))
```
此函数将创建一个名为 “my-pcell” 的 PCell,然后将两个 CDF 属性添加到 PCell 中。
3. 定义一个函数,该函数将从文件中读取 CDF 属性并将其添加到 PCell 中。例如:
```
(defun add-cdf-from-file (filename)
(let ((new-pcell (make-pcell 'my-pcell)))
(read-cdf-properties new-pcell filename)
new-pcell))
```
此函数将从名为 “filename” 的文件中读取 CDF 属性,并将其添加到名为 “my-pcell” 的 PCell 中。
4. 保存 SKILL 文件,并在设计工具中加载该文件。
5. 调用您编写的函数以添加 CDF 属性到 PCell 中。例如,如果您使用第一个函数创建 PCell,则可以在设计工具中运行以下代码:
```
(add-cdf-to-pcell)
```
此代码将创建一个具有两个 CDF 属性的 PCell,并将其添加到设计工具的库中。
需要注意的是,上述代码仅为示例,具体实现将取决于您的设计工具和所需的 CDF 属性。因此,请确保参考您使用的设计工具的文档以获取详细的指导。
写一个简单的mos PCell
以下是一个简单的 MOS PCell,用于创建一个 nMOSFET:
```
PCELL nmos (
PIN G,
PIN D,
PIN S,
PARAM W = 1,
PARAM L = 0.1,
PARAM TOX = 0.01,
PARAM VTH = 0.5,
PARAM KP = 2e-5
)
{
DEVICE nmos (
WIDTH = W,
LENGTH = L,
TOX = TOX,
VTH = VTH,
KP = KP
)
CONNECT (
G = G,
D = D,
S = S
)
}
```
使用这个 PCell,可以方便地创建各种不同尺寸和性能的 nMOSFET,只需要调整宽度、长度、氧化层厚度、阈值电压和电流增益等参数即可。